Transaction 3e86a86ab8363bf8d78a865a1d952b5711a0522e19b7439d293c41329c227f47

1 Input
2 Outputs
  • 3e86a86ab8363bf8d78a865a1d952b5711a0522e19b7439d293c41329c227f47:0
  • value  138571376
    address  32itEHnppdNRcHo3mKqqnx8MK6n6xtHkzZ
  • 3e86a86ab8363bf8d78a865a1d952b5711a0522e19b7439d293c41329c227f47:1
  • value  50425
    address  1gLzZj6FMCN5muCRQmXXbQdApCnQ5Kw6Q